**Q: How do I migrate my build target to Hermit, our hermetic build system?**

Short answer: start with the leaf targets and work upward. Hermit refuses anything that reads from the host environment, so pin your toolchains and vendor every dependency into the lockfile. Most breakage comes from scripts that shell out to system binaries — wrap those in declared tools instead. The migration guide in the Quarryside repo covers the weird cases. Still stuck after that? Drop us a line.

alerts address for tajeg-tahag: juldor.zordor.fenys@plorvaforge.corp

- [ ] **Step 7: Breaker override escrow.** After sealing the signing keys for the Tallgrove upstream API circuit breaker, confirm the support team can force the breaker open during a full outage. The override bundle lives in the sealed escrow drawer and is useless without its unlock phrase. Two ceremony witnesses must initial this step before proceeding. The escrow bundle is decrypted with the recovery passphrase that follows.

vault phrase of kahip-kahop = holath-quenmir

## Deployment

The Larkspur API tier talks to Postgres through our in-house pooler, Tapwell. Each API pod gets its own pool; do not share pools across pods or you'll exhaust connections during scale-up. Pool sizing is tuned per environment, so never copy staging numbers into production. On deploy, the entrypoint script validates pool settings before accepting traffic and fails fast on bad values. Set the following configuration before starting the service.

deployment values, fahap-hahaf:
[casdor]
port = 9200
region = south-2
host = casdor.qirvanworks.corp
timeout_ms = 3000
retries = 4

## Formula sandbox tuning

User-supplied formulas in Gridmoor execute inside a restricted interpreter with hard ceilings on time, memory, and call depth. Reviewers should confirm any change to these ceilings is justified in the PR description, since raising them widens the abuse surface. Defaults were chosen from production traces. The current limits are as follows.

limits module of tafog-fawip:
WEIGHTS = {
    "julix": 57,
    "lamys": 992,
    "kasvan": 209,
    "quenok": 750,
    "alddor": 259,
    "oliath": 1009,
    "wenix": 815,
}